Historical Landmarks
Pingyang has a long history, dating back to the Eastern Han Dynasty (25-220 AD). The city boasts numerous historical landmarks that offer a glimpse into its past. One of the most famous sites is the ancient city wall, which was built in the Southern Song Dynasty (1127-1279 AD). As you stroll along the wall, you can imagine the bustling city it once was.
Ancient City Wall
- Location: The city wall runs along the north side of the old town.
- Description: The wall is about 1.5 kilometers long and 7 meters high.
- Highlights: The wall features watchtowers, battlements, and a moat.
Scenic Spots
Pingyang is not only rich in history but also offers stunning natural landscapes. Here are some of the most beautiful spots you can visit:
Longnian Mountain
- Location: Longnian Mountain is located in the southeastern part of Pingyang.
- Description: The mountain has an elevation of 596 meters and is covered in lush greenery throughout the year.
- Highlights: Visitors can enjoy panoramic views of the surrounding countryside from the top of the mountain.
Pingyang Lake
- Location: Pingyang Lake is situated in the central part of Pingyang.
- Description: The lake covers an area of 10 square kilometers and is a popular spot for boating and fishing.
- Highlights: The lake is surrounded by hills and offers a serene environment for relaxation.
Cultural Experiences
Pingyang is a city with a strong cultural heritage. Here are some of the cultural experiences you can have while visiting:
Local Cuisine
- Dishes: Local dishes in Pingyang include “Bianyao” (a type of rice noodle) and “Pingyang braised pork.”
- Tasting: You can taste these dishes at local restaurants or street food stalls.
Traditional Crafts
- Crafts: Pingyang is famous for its traditional crafts, such as paper-cutting and embroidery.
- Experiencing: You can learn about these crafts at local workshops or purchase souvenirs made from these materials.
